Output de2cf05efd17f1da709456aa2ad2984b9a591dfe64266887fefd6dfbe764bfb4:93

value
80900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cceba534676f61c3d7157bc61521bda045123a47 OP_EQUALVERIFY OP_CHECKSIG
address
1KgX94NDbWhrKUzCYAdQ8ttSicE86QdhKd
transaction
de2cf05efd17f1da709456aa2ad2984b9a591dfe64266887fefd6dfbe764bfb4
confirmations
612828
spent
true